3. 接口知识和模型知识

1.接口四要素

接口的四个组成要素

请求地址,请求方式,请求参数,响应数据

响应数据一般是json格式的数据

请求参数如果是get/delete请求,参数是key=value&key=value
请求参数如果是post/put请求,参数是json格式

接口来源

自己写的(JavaWeb,SSM框架,SpringBoot,SpringCloud)
第三方提供的数据接口(代码由第三方编写,底层的逻辑和编程语言不需要考虑)
自有的数据接口可以实现项目功能,第三方数据接口是用来提供一些通用数据的(天气数据、地理纬度数据等等)
不管是自有的数据接口还是第三方提供的数据接口都得有接口文档

4个接口参数

get查/post添加/put改/delete删

apipost软件简单介绍


2. 模型

需求明确:

瀑布模型:从上至下,不回头,若回头,推翻重来

需求明确,快速开发

增量模型:功能模块化
迭代模型:按时间划分,茅草屋->木屋->别墅

需求不明确,风险低

原型模型:快速梳理需求

需求不明确,风险高

螺旋模型:需求不明确,风险高,迭代原型,风控做好后,最后开发
体现了瀑布模型、迭代模型、原型模型

需求不明确,经常变化:

敏捷开发模型:需求可变,
Scrum 是用于开发、交付和持续支持复杂产品的一个框架,是一个增量的、迭代的开发过程。
在这个框架中,整个开发过程由若干个短的迭代周期组成,一个短的迭代周期称为一个冲刺,多个自组织和自治的小组并行地递增实现产品。

SCRUM是一种可以集合各种开发实践的经验化过程框架。SCRUM中发布产品的重要性高于一切。是对迭代式面向对象方法的改进。

人机交互,可工作的软件高于详尽的文档,客户合作高于合同谈判,随时应对变化
1.产品代办列表:根据用户价值进行优先级排序的高层要求
2.冲刺代办列表:要在冲刺中完成的任务的清单
3.产品增量:最终交付给客户的内容

3. apache

apache基金会是全球最大的一个开源软件孵化基地,很多的大型出名的开源软件都来自于Apache基金会。

posted @ 2022-06-09 18:50  jsqup  阅读(118)  评论(0编辑  收藏  举报